Years after closing all locations, New York’s oldest department store is making a comeback!
America’s oldest department store chain is returning!
Lord & Taylor Files For Bankruptcy, Closes All Stores
Lord & Taylor was established in 1826. The company sold its flagship building on Fifth Avenue in New York City in 2019.
In 2020, the company filed for Chapter 11 Bankruptcy.
By 2021 all locations nationwide were closed after years of financial issues…